Overview

Waterloo Park in Marsfield is a community recreation space managed by the City of Ryde, featuring sports facilities and open green areas. The park contains a designated cricket pitch and multi-purpose sports fields used by local clubs. It provides children's playground equipment and basic amenities for families. As of August 2026, the grounds are maintained as a functional suburban recreational site. The layout emphasizes flat grassy areas suitable for exercise and neighborhood gatherings. It serves as a localized green corridor within the Marsfield residential district.

Insider tips

Bring your own portable seating or picnic blankets as permanent bench seating is limited.

Check local City of Ryde sports schedules online before arriving, as fields may be reserved for organized matches.

Visit during weekdays to avoid the high demand for parking during weekend youth sports leagues.
